
Can Sertraline Cause Increased Sedation And Fatigue?

Question: My dad is taking Carbidopa-Levodopa dopamine 25-100 tab 3x per day. He has gotten weak such as not be able to move as well, stand as long, wants to stay longer in bed, etc. He has been on since XXXXXXX 8. He is 91 and was put on Serra line at same time. I am suspecting the 1st medication is causing the weakness. The Dr has been unreachable. How can I taper him off the C-L?
Brief Answer:
Reduce sertraline first
Detailed Answer:
Hello,
I have gone through your question and understand your concerns.
It is more likely, that sertraline is causing increased sedation and fatigue.
Carbidopa and levodopa is used for parkinson's disease and usually may cause postural hypotension.
You can decrease the dose of sertraline first.
Visit and consult with the treating doctor.
